The share of live crown lost to fungal leaf blight, which hits blue gum hardest in its juvenile foliage during the wet establishment years before the canopy transitions to more resistant adult leaves.
Mycosphaerella and Teratosphaeria leaf blights routinely strip 10–30% of juvenile blue gum crowns in wetter years; sustained heavy defoliation can cut rotation volume materially.
DPIRD WA ↗Because photosynthesis lives in the crown, defoliation translates almost directly into lost height and volume. Tracking it through the susceptible early years tells you whether a genetic or chemical intervention is warranted before growth is permanently pegged back.

Plant families selected for leaf-blight tolerance on high-risk sites.
Favour wider spacing and airflow to shorten leaf-wetness periods.
Monitor juvenile crowns through wet springs to time any response.
